Circuit design of backup power with rechargeable battery

A 12V lead acid battery has 14.4V when fully charged. NiCd and NiMH have around 1.2V per cell. LiIon have 4.1V to 4.2V per cell when fully charged. So what kind of battery you want to use will have big influence on whyt kind of circuit will work. In the circuit you found the Source with the higher voltage will "win" and supply the circuit.

How does a battery backup system work?

First, you need a DC power supply. These are very common and come in a variety of voltages and current ratings. The power supply connects to the circuit with a DC power connector. This is then connected to a blocking diode. The blocking diode prevents electricity from the battery backup system from feeding back into the power supply.

How does a rechargeable battery work?

Next, a rechargeable battery is connected using a resistor and another diode. The resistor allows the battery to be slowly charged from the power supply, and the diode provides a low resistance path between the battery and the circuit so that it can power the circuit if the voltage of the power supply ever drops too low.
